Toucan Play That Game

A blog about life...literally

B. trifoliolata: A New Master of Disguise

There is something deeply fascinating about disguises, especially when the disguises arise from evolutionary roots. Camouflage has proved to be the saving grace of many species that would otherwise be picked out easily, be it a benign frog colored similarly

The iGEM Competition

E. coli that can determine the purity of water, bacteria that change color depending on lighting to form a living photograph – these are not just new technologies being produced by scientists in a laboratory, they are projects made by

